Mozzarella-Stuffed Turkey Meatloaf

Say hello to this mouthwatering Mozzarella-Stuffed Turkey Meatloaf that's sure to become a family favorite! With gooey mozzarella cheese hidden inside and a flavorful turkey base, this dish is a delightful twist on the classic comfort food.

Mozzarella-Stuffed Turkey Meatloaf

Ingredients

for 4 servings

Sauce

  • 1 cup tomato sauce (225 g)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on honey

Meatloaf

  • 1 lb lean ground turkey (455 g)
  • 1 cup shredded zucchini (150 g), excess moisture gently squeezed out with kitchen towels
  • 1 cup finely diced yellow onion (150 g)
  • 2 cloves gar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 large egg, beaten
  • 1 tablespoon d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• ½ cup panko bread crumbs
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on pepper
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on dried basil
  • 2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h parsley, plus more for garnish
  • 2 slices mozzarella cheese

Preparation

  1. Preheat the oven to 375˚F (190˚C).
  2. Make the sauce: In a medium bowl, stir together the tomato sauce, apple cider vinegar, and honey.
  3. Make the meatloaf: In a large bowl, combine the ground turkey, zucchini, onion, garlic, egg, Dijon mustard, honey, 2 tablespoons of the sauce, the panko, salt, pepper, oregano, basil, and parsley. Mix well.
  4. Add half of the meatloaf mixture to a greased loaf pan and flatten in an even layer.
  5. Layer the cheese over the meat. Top with the rest of the meatloaf mixture and smooth the top.
  6. Top the meatloaf with half of remaining sauce, using a spoon or rubber spatula to spread evenly. Reserve the rest of the sauce.
  7. Bake the meatloaf for 1 hour, or until the internal temperature reaches 160˚F (70˚C).
  8. Warm the reserved sauce in the microwave or a skillet, then drizzle on top of the meatloaf.
  9. Garnish with fresh parsley and serve with your favorite sides (we like mashed sweet potatoes and asparagus).
